Former Binance Head for the CIS, Smerkis, Sentenced to Five Years in Fraud Case

Vladimir Smerkis, the former head of the Binance cryptocurrency exchange in the CIS countries, has been sentenced to five years in prison in a case involving fraud on an especially large scale.

This was reported by Russian media outlets.

According to the investigation, in 2024, a crypto blogger approached Smerkis with a request to run an advertising campaign to attract new followers on social media. Smerkis allegedly promised to bring in about 2 million new users and received over 8.8 million rubles for this.

image

Investigators claim that after receiving the funds, he failed to deliver the promised service.

The court found 41-year-old Smerkis guilty of fraud on an especially large scale.
